■ The single point of obsession: an "unfading signal"
In the scalping world, the most troublesome signals are those that repaint later or disappear after a restart when the location moves—signals that fade away.
Even if a past chart looks impressively clean, in real time it may not appear in the same form—many have experienced this.
AI SuperNova Sign Pro is designed with a top priority: a "completely no repaint policy" where once a arrow/signal appears, it is not erased or changed.
Because scalping relies on quick judgments on short timeframes, trusting the information at the moment of display is more important than anything else.
■ An AI-based suppression layer to reduce wasted entries
As more tools with AI appear, what we valued was a design that can explain what it does and what it does not do.
The Advanced AI of AI SuperNova evaluates arrow candidates produced by rule-based logic with another AI layer that decides allowance or suppression.
It can be toggled in three levels: OFF/SOFT/HARD, and AI will not create new arrows; it only acts to suppress signals in weaker situations.
By reducing the number of signals, we aim to help reduce the "weakly justified entries" that scalping tends to exhaust you with.
Using SOFT/HARD tends to reduce signal count, but this does not guarantee win rate or results; it is merely a tool to narrow down the decision material.
■ Display design that supports entry accuracy
When the arrow appears, the price level is indicated with a white circle, and target lines for TP1/TP2/SL are displayed simultaneously, making it easy to judge consistently “how long to wait after entry and where to protect.”
Additionally, we added Force-style displays to indicate market momentum and an MTF display to confirm the direction of higher timeframes.
If you only look at very short bars like M1, your view can become narrow. By keeping higher-timeframe information in view, you can reduce situations where you entered per the signal but went against you.
Supported timeframes range from M1 to D1, enabling the same design philosophy signals to be used for scalping to day trading and swing trading.
